LeadIQ is a prospecting platform that helps outbound sales teams build pipeline through contact data, a AI cold email writing assistant, contact and account tracking for job changes, and CRM enrichment, all integrated into sales tools used daily.

RainKing is less appropriate when you don't have the funds or resources to pay for it. You could easily Google the information that you're looking for, or use CrunchBase, but it's extremely time-consuming. RainKing makes this very easy and the data seamlessly sends to Salesforce with the proper integration. RainKing is very appropriate when you have a large team of folks that need to source leads/accounts simultaneously and need licenses to do so - it's worth the money with a larger team.
Capturing contact and lead information: Name, Designation, Phone Numbers, Work Email Address, Company board line number - almost every single data point one needs in lead or demand generation. The checkmark for verified information is a cherry on the cake.
LeadIQ integrates with LinkedIn Sales Navigator, Salesforce, and even SalesLoft pretty well. A simple click of a button from LSN can import the lead into Salesforce. A boon for any Outbound sales team. Additionally, capturing multiple contacts in a single go as well as importing them into a cadence is a time--saver.
It's also a community. Since users can suggest changes to make lead information more accurate as well as the option to request more information on a particular lead.

So far not a happy customer. We have had a few positive results but for the most part, all phone numbers are relatively inaccurate or they are personal numbers scraped from LinkedIn. When calling a personal number, people are surprised and find it intrusive.
We would not recommend this service until it invests more into correct corporate switchboard numbers at the bare minimum. Currently, these are often incorrect.
